How Windows 10 Will Manage Compatibility Challenges When Upgrading from Windows 7

Posted: Dec 26, 2016
Windows 7 and 8.1 customers can upgrade to Windows 10 without paying a single cent, as well as the method will be performed automatically as soon as the new operating program becomes obtainable, but naturally, due to the fact you happen to be jumping from one Windows version to an additional, compatibility concerns are a thing that everybody is afraid of.
Microsoft says that, yes, compatibility issues are attainable, but it really is working to tackle all of them, and it really is extremely necessary to understand what specifically is incorrect and could block your personal computer from obtaining Windows 10 to be able to manually repair it, if attainable, ahead of it really is too late.
The Get Windows 10 app that's now supposed to become running on the majority of Windows 7 and 8.1 computer systems must enable decide any compatibility challenges that might exist, and Microsoft groups them into three numerous categories: app incompatibilities, device incompatibilities, and Computer settings. Needless to say, this can be pretty most likely to be the most standard problem that Windows 7 customers are anticipated to come across when moving to Windows 10.
Many of the apps which can be presently operating on their computers may possibly not be compatible with Windows 10, so they're going to either fail to launch around the new OS or launch but not work effectively. Microsoft says that, if it detects such matters, it might possibly prompt users to eliminate them during the upgrade approach "because the app interferences using the setup procedure and prevents it from finishing properly."
That's expected to come about rarely, even though, as most software developers would get their apps completely compatible with Windows 10 prior to the new OS launches.
This is the far more high-priced and painful problem that users may well expertise given that, in case a piece of hardware is not compatible with Windows 10, it requirements to either be replaced or disabled till new drivers are being provided by the manufacturer.
"This could outcome inside a degraded knowledge or possibly a total failure with the device to function," Microsoft explains. "Some devices or Pc elements could be vital to Windows 10 functioning properly, and if such a device is incompatible, you can expect to not be able to upgrade to Windows 10."
And last but not least, many of the settings that you've produced in your Windows 7 laptop could also avoid Windows 10 from installing properly. If this occurs, Microsoft says that it could demand a clean set up of Windows 10, so in other words, you happen to be going to shed all of your settings, but individual files are going to be migrated.
